Presidents of Uzbekistan and Tajikistan visit Bukhara
The President of Uzbekistan, Shavkat Mirziyoyev, has arrived in the city of Bukhara to participate in the events scheduled for the second day of the Uzbekistan – Tajikistan summit. Upon arrival at the Bukhara International Airport, the head of state personally welcomed the President of Tajikistan, Emomali Rahmon, who is currently in the country on a high-level state visit.

The arrival was marked by a solemn welcoming ceremony held in honor of the distinguished guest. The reception featured vibrant performances of national songs and traditional dances, reflecting the deep cultural ties and mutual respect between the two neighboring nations.
The agenda for today includes a visit by the two leaders to the historic monuments of ancient Bukhara, a city renowned for its architectural heritage and status as a center of Islamic civilization. In addition to exploring these historical landmarks, the presidents are expected to visit several local industrial enterprises.
These site visits are intended to showcase the region's economic potential and foster further cooperation in trade and manufacturing between Uzbekistan and Tajikistan.
